Teen and Adolescent Intensive Outpatient Program (IOP)

Kolmac offers structured adolescent intensive outpatient programs designed for teens who need more clinical support than weekly therapy but do not require inpatient hospitalization. Our teen IOP programs provide multiple sessions per week, combining individual therapy, skills-based group work, family involvement, and psychiatric services within a single coordinated care team.

Programs are available during day and evening hours, with both in-person and virtual options, so adolescents can continue attending school and maintaining family routines while receiving intensive clinical care.

What We Treat

Adolescents often struggle with conditions that can significantly interfere with daily functioning. Our adolescent mental health treatment addresses:

  • Anxiety disorders
  • Depression and mood dysregulation
  • Trauma-related symptoms and PTSD
  • Behavioral and emotional challenges, including ADHD
  • Stress that impacts school, home, or relationships

These concerns can appear in many forms and intensities. Early and appropriate support through adolescent counseling and treatment increases the likelihood of meaningful improvement.

How Teen IOP and Outpatient Therapy Work

We use evidence-based therapeutic approaches tailored to the developmental needs of adolescents. Teen therapy and teen counseling at Kolmac are designed to help teens understand and manage overwhelming emotions, build healthy coping strategies, strengthen interpersonal and family communication, improve functioning at school and home, and build resilience and long-term wellbeing.

Treatment approaches include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), structured individual therapy, skills-based groups, family involvement, and care coordination with schools and external supports. Our adolescent outpatient programs consider the whole teen, not just symptoms.

Teen PHP and Partial Hospitalization for Adolescents

For adolescents who need a higher level of structure, Kolmac offers a Partial Hospitalization Program (PHP). Adolescent PHP provides more intensive daily programming than IOP while still allowing teens to return home each evening. This level of care is appropriate for teens stepping down from inpatient or residential treatment, or for those whose symptoms require more support than an intensive outpatient program alone can provide.

Family Therapy and Support for Adolescent Mental Health

Family involvement is a core component of adolescent treatment. Effective teen mental health care engages caregivers in education, communication strategies, and tools to support sustained progress at home. Family therapy sessions help strengthen relationships and equip parents with practical approaches for navigating their teen’s challenges. Peer support and age-appropriate group components help teens develop social skills and connection with others facing similar experiences.

Goals of Adolescent Counseling and Treatment

The primary goals of adolescent mental health treatment are to reduce symptom severity, improve daily functioning and quality of life, strengthen emotional regulation and coping, support academic engagement, and build lasting skills for resilience and self-management. Every treatment plan is individualized to the specific needs, strengths, and circumstances of each teen and their family.
